The Arkansas Department of Education - Office of Early Childhood releases a new Childcare secure, user-friendly portal empowering families to find licensed childcare providers statewide with smart search capabilities around City, Zip Code, County and star quality ratings, availability, and direct connections to support services.
Every child in Arkansas deserves a safe, supportive environment to grow and thrive. This portal makes it easier than ever for parents to make informed decisions about their child’s care, early education and helps strengthen transparency and trust in early learning across the state.

This month, the Arkansas Department of Education launched the ACCESS website. The Arkansas ACCESS Act is Governor Sarah Huckabee Sanders’ higher education overhaul plan that the Arkansas Legislature enacted during this year’s regular session.
The higher education plan builds upon the transformational success of the LEARNS Act and focuses on aligning pre-kindergarten to post-secondary education to ensure students graduate ready for enrollment, enlistment or employment, the state Department of Education said in a news release.
The web portal, available at https://access.ade.arkansas.gov/, is a one-stop location for all things involving implementation, the department said.
Focusing on the six key aspects of ACCESS (Acceleration, Common Sense, Cost, Eligibility, Scholarships and Standardization), the website provides details about each of the categories and links to additional information.
In addition to providing more information about each of the categories, the website includes a link to the legislation, frequently asked questions and updates regarding ACCESS. The site also houses links to each of the colleges and universities in Arkansas and will include a link to the Direct Admissions Portal once developed.
